Electromagnetic loss properties of ZnO nanofibers

ZnO nanofibers were fabricated by electrospinning method. The morphology and microstructure of the as-prepared ZnO nanofibers were studied in details. The ZnO nanofibers showed pure polycrystalline phase with the hexagonal wurtzite structure. The average diameter of the ZnO nanofibers, calcined at 550 A degrees C, was around 140 nm. Moreover, the electromagnetic loss properties of the as-prepared ZnO nanofibers were investigated. The mechanism of dielectric loss could be attributed to the electric dipolar polarization and interface polarization. The mechanism of magnetic loss properties were mainly caused by natural resonance and exchange resonance. The networks of ZnO nanofibers also facilitated dissipating electromagnetic energy. The dielectric loss factor tan delta(epsilon) was around 0.06085 and the magnetic loss factor tan delta(mu) was approximate 0.04095. The as-prepared ZnO nanofiber exhibited excellent electromagnetic loss properties and it could be usd as a potential candidate for lightweight microwave absorption material.
